What is the specific segment of DNA where RNA polymerase attaches to initiate the process of transcription?

The promoter region is the DNA sequence where RNA polymerase binds to begin transcription. Terminators signal the end of transcription, anti-terminators prevent termination, and operators regulate gene expression but do not initiate transcription.
